Case summary
She is a resident of St. Petersburg, a translator. In August 2023, she was detained in connection with the initiation of a criminal case on discrediting the Armed Forces because of a solitary picket with a placard "FREEDOM TO NAVALNOMU! FREEDOM TO ALL POLITICAL PRISONERS NO WAR!". The court imposed a preventive measure in the form of a ban on certain actions. The investigation was completed in four days, but then resumed, after which another episode appeared in the case: a solitary picket on 29 April 2023 with the poster "A world without war. Russia without Putin", because of which Abramova was initially reported under Article 20.3.3 of the Code of Administrative Offences. The case was referred to the court, but on 21 December the court returned it to the prosecutor's office, considering that the law enforcers had violated the procedure for initiating criminal proceedings against a member of the election commission with the right to casting vote. In May 2024, the case was reopened. On 25 March 2025, Abramova was sentenced to two years in a general regime colony. On 4 August 2025, the court of appeal replaced the general regime colony with a settlement colony.
